On 11/05/2020 09:38, Szabolcs Nagy wrote:
> The 05/08/2020 14:44, Adhemerval Zanella via Libc-alpha wrote:
>> On 30/04/2020 14:45, Szabolcs Nagy wrote:
>>> +++ b/sysdeps/aarch64/sysdep.h
>>> @@ -35,6 +35,16 @@
>>>
>>> #define PTR_SIZE (1<<PTR_LOG_SIZE)
>>>
>>> +/* Strip pointer authentication code from pointer p. */
>>> +#define XPAC(p) ({ \
>>> + register void *__ra asm ("x30") = (p); \
>>> + asm ("hint 7 // xpaclri" : "+r"(__ra)); \
>>> + __ra;})
>>> +
>>> +/* This is needed when glibc is built with -mbranch-protection=pac-ret. */
>>> +#undef RETURN_ADDRESS
>>> +#define RETURN_ADDRESS(n) XPAC(__builtin_return_address(n))
>>> +
>>
>> Maybe use a inline function instead?
>
> macro seems more reliable to me than always_inline
> when poking at __builtin_return_address and x30,
> but i'm not against always_inline if that's
> considered better.
I would prefer a static inline unless a macro is really required
(either due some compiler limitation or bug).
>
> i'd prefer separate xpac (since it can be used
> not just with __builtin_return_address e.g. for
> stored code address in jmpbuf, which currently
> uses ptrmangling)
Ack.
>
>> #ifndef __ASSEMBLER__
>> # include <sys/cdefs.h>
>
> what is cdefs.h for?
The __always_inline macro.
>
>> /* Strip pointer authentication code from pointer p. */
>> static __always_inline void *
>> return_address (unsigned int n)
>> {
>> register void *ra asm ("x30") = __builtin_return_address (n);
>> asm ("hint 7 // xpaclri" : "+r" (ra));
>> return ra;
>> }
>>
>> /* This is needed when glibc is built with -mbranch-protection=pac-ret. */
>> # undef RETURN_ADDRESS
>> # define RETURN_ADDRESS(n) return_address (n)
>> #endif
